Mainstreaming Natural Asset Management

The challenges of aging infrastructure, climate change, biodiversity loss and high level of service requirements, coupled with the declining rate of re-investment on infrastructure and high renewal and replacement costs, require civil infrastructure to be managed efficiently and sustainably. Integrating nature and the services it provides into infrastructure considerations is an innovative approach to develop long-term sustainable infrastructure systems that addresses the issues facing communities today. The Natural Assets Initiative (NAI) team provides scientific, economic and municipal expertise to support and guide local governments in identifying, valuing and accounting for natural assets in their financial planning and asset management programs, and in developing leading-edge, sustainable and climate resilient infrastructure. To date NAI has worked with over 120 communities across Canada on a range of projects. This presentation will speak to rapidly advancing practices in natural asset management, including a new standard for natural asset inventories, as well as accounting frameworks to accelerate more abundant, equitable, and thriving natural assets.
